There would be little argument from either inside or outside of Old Trafford that Manchester United are not having the greatest season in their history with a managerial merry-go-round, embarrassing defeats, and looking uncompetitive in the EPL or Europe.

As a result, bookmakers have been happy to come up with some special football bets that we can make on various potential outcomes regarding their season including them not finishing in the top 6 in the EPL and to not winning a trophy ranked a 5/2 chance - That means pretty likely!

Bookmakers only give Ralf Rangnick a 45% chance of remaining at the club until the end of the season along with a host of other shocking crisis type bets.

There are markets regarding Ralf Rangnick remaining in place and some players too, like Sancho departing, or even Phil Jones become permanent captain of the club.

Add to that, speculation on Harry Maguire not being at United next season at just 7/2 and it is up to you how worthy you think some of these possibilities are. The Premier League statistics don't make for great reading for United right now, that's for sure.

Manchester United in Crisis Betting Odds

In light of the 'off-colour' season Manchester United are having bookmakers have been quick to come up with some special bets based on what might happen between now and the end of the season including predicting just 5/2 that United will neither win a trophy this year and finish outside of the top 6 in the Premier League.

Market Odds Probability
Ralf Rangnick to be Manager to the end of the season 4/6 60.0%
RR to not be in charge at the end of the season 6/5 45.45%
NO trophy and outside the Top 6 5/2 28.57%
Harry Maguire to leave before next season 7/2 22.22%
Sancho to go to Dortmund before next season 9/1 10.0%
Phil Jones to be Permanent Captain before the end of the season 33/1 2.94%
Man Utd to finish in bottom half 33/1 2.94%
